Open
Description
Thank you for the great work on docker-gen.
I want to sort my containers using container-number
, but I think this is not supported yet, or I might be doing it wrong.
sort by Labels.com.docker.compose.container-number
{{ $backends := sortObjectsByKeysAsc (whereLabelValueMatches . "com.example.haproxy.backend" "true") "Labels.com.docker.compose.container-number" }}
result:
server app-3 172.25.0.3:443
server app-9 172.25.0.4:443
server app-8 172.25.0.5:443
server app-4 172.25.0.6:443
server app-7 172.25.0.7:443
server app-10 172.25.0.8:443
server app-1 172.25.0.9:443
server app-2 172.25.0.10:443
server app-6 172.25.0.11:443
server app-5 172.25.0.12:443
sort by Name
{{ $backends := sortObjectsByKeysAsc (whereLabelValueMatches . "com.example.haproxy.backend" "true") "Name" }}
result:
server app-1 172.25.0.9:443
server app-10 172.25.0.8:443
server app-2 172.25.0.10:443
server app-3 172.25.0.3:443
server app-4 172.25.0.6:443
server app-5 172.25.0.12:443
server app-6 172.25.0.11:443
server app-7 172.25.0.7:443
server app-8 172.25.0.5:443
server app-9 172.25.0.4:443